Hermes praise.

Now that is a title that isn't seen very often.
A reminder to those who send parcels/packages and try to save a few pennies by not paying for the extra cover in the event of loss.
I sent an eBay sale via Hermes which was showing as out for delivery on the 10th Jan.. It wasn't delivered.
Total value, including Hermes' fee £37 and pence. I paid extra for up to £40.
The buyer was understanding and patient but I refunded them when Hermes declared the package "lost". Their comms have been excellent. I completed a claim form, the eBay listing number plus other information was sufficient.
A week later they advised that a refund had been made for the full amount. Now received.
However, they shouldn't have lost it in the first.:p
